Overview: The Granby Planning Board recently convened to address several issues concerning the town’s development and regulations, including a discrepancy in a beer and wine license application and zoning complications related to lot sizes within the water supply protection district. The meeting also covered the scheduling of a public hearing for a special events permit, complaints about a Golf Center’s operating hours, and the processing of an application for a community grant.

Overview: During a recent Opa-Locka City Commission meeting, the most discussions revolved around emergency preparedness, particularly with hurricane season approaching, and the unanimous approval for the implementation of a summer youth jobs program. The commission also addressed the community’s concerns about public safety, illegal dumping, and the need for proactive measures, including the authorization to enter into an agreement with a public relations and marketing firm to improve the city’s image.

Overview: In a recent Morris Town Council meeting, significant amendments to the Red Bull Arena Inc. ’s General Development Plan (GDP) and major site plan were approved. The amendments proposed a reduction in the size and scope of the Red Bulls’ training facility, adjustments to the landscaping, and changes to the project’s construction timing. The council unanimously carried the motion to approve the amended application, noting the benefits the project would bring to the town and praising the collaborative effort of all parties involved, including public contributions.

Overview: In a recent meeting of the Wildwood Crest Borough Council, the most pressing topic discussed was the Bayfront improvements project, aimed at addressing flood mitigation and revitalizing storm sewer infrastructure. The project, presented by representatives Mark Deasio and Matt Abrams, is estimated to cost about $6 million and includes elevating borough bulkheads to Elevation 8, replacing existing bulkheads, and raising roadways. The project also plans for the installation of manually operated control valves and the consideration of future storm sewer pump stations.
